Sebastian Riedl1
M, b. 20 January 1769
Sebastian Riedl was born on 20 January 1769 at Inchenhofen, Bavaria, Germany.1 He married (1) Teresia Habbacherin.1 He married (2) Magdalena Spielberger on 13 November 1807.1 Sebastian Riedl died at Inchenhofen, Bavaria.1
Family | Magdalena Spielberger b. 22 Jul 1783 |
Child |
|
He was "Burgerlicher Schmeid" (Smith) of Inchenhofen, House #84. Burgerlich means he became a burger or citizen of Inchenhofen, that he was not a native.1

Catherine Riley1
F, d. 27 September 1883
Catherine Riley married ? Riley.1 Catherine Riley died on 27 September 1883 at Leonia (Ridgefield Township), NJ.1
Family | ? Riley d. b 27 Sep 1883 |
Children |
|
Text on filecard
Catherine Riley Catherine Riley and Jacob Riley, her son, both died 27 Sep 1883 at Leonia, Ridgefield Township, leaving the following heirs at law: Augustus Riley and Daniel Riley of Leonia, NJ, Catherine Cooper (widow), of NY, John Riley, of NY, and David Riley, of MD, children of Mrs. Riley. Also Charles Bohde of New Orleans, LA, George Bohde, Emma C. Bohde, Tillie M. Bohde and Edward Bohde 19 yrs old, of NY, children of Caroline F. Bohde, a dec'd daughter of Mrs. Riley.1

Elizabeth Ring1
F, d. 28 December 1687
Elizabeth Ring was born at Suffolk, England, (She was of Ufford at marriage.)1 She was baptized on 23 February 1601/2 at Ufford, Suffolk, England.1 She married Josiah Cooke, son of Francis Cooke and Hester Mahieu, on 16 September 1635 at Plymouth, MA.1 Elizabeth Ring died on 28 December 1687 at Plymouth, Plymouth County, MA.1
